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02205886815 125554 39093103813
59 72887386
59 72887386
68218470 619 0722 62873978
All about undefined
Interested in learning more?
59 72887386
68218470 619 0722 62873978
See more
07 45619586717 4734339700
00051337401 598817 6306 92054665 00
See more
367 0366
173 515 120287958
See more